Solar modules generate electricity, but modern customers need power systems that can store energy, dispatch energy, support critical loads, communicate with operators, respond to grid conditions, and produce reliable performance data.
A microgrid is a localized energy system that can disconnect from the traditional grid and operate autonomously.
The microgrid can "island" — disconnect from the main grid and continue powering critical loads during grid outages, blackouts, or emergencies.
